Empirical evaluation of the socio-economic impacts of renewable energies in Morocco by 2035 : an input-output model

2022 - Franco Angeli

193-217 p.

The objective of the study is to identify scenarios relating to solar and wind renewable energy technologies by 2035 in Morocco, and to simulate their socioeconomic effects (GDP, Value added by sector and employment). This consists in calculating the effect of these scenarios in comparison with a trend scenario that extends recent developments and takes into account the industrial integration policy already decided on both solar and wind technologies. The methodology applied is based on a dynamic InputOutput (IO) model. Three simulation sce narios are discussed in this study for the assessment of the socioeconomic impacts of concentrated solar power, photovoltaic and wind energy on the Moroccan economy during the period 20202035. Also, a comparative analysis between the scenarios developed and the targets indicated in the national strategies, in terms of economic and job creation indicators, reveals a significant potential in terms of job creation and value added.
